Factors that Affect Solar Panel Costs in Marbletown
Though the average cost of a solar system in Marbletown is $11,137, your actual cost may be higher or lower than that. There are several factors that can have a major impact on the cost of a solar panel installation. Below are some of the more important things to take into consideration.
Solar Equipment
When it comes to estimating the price of a solar panel system in Marbletown, one of the most important factors is the size of the system you need. Solar systems are sized by kilowatts (kW) and are mainly based on your home’s energy usage, which you can determine by looking at past power bills. Your total cost can increase by around $3,650 for each additional kilowatt you need.There are several different solar panel brands and the one you pick also affects the cost. In many cases, the brands that have better efficiency tend to also cost more. Additionally, the type of equipment you’re looking to install can affect your total cost. If you just need panels, your system will be far less expensive than if you also need solar batteries or an electric vehicle charger.
Solar Financing Terms
Most solar companies in Marbletown offer solar loans, which reduce your upfront costs of installing solar panels.It’s wise to add the interest you’ll pay in your final cost estimate. If you can afford to pay a higher down payment, you can reduce your total costs and how long it’ll take to pay back the loan.
Solar Panel Installation Company
The solar installation company you select will affect your total cost to adopt solar power. Different companies will charge different amounts for the equipment and labor.Some companies only sell high-efficiency and high-priced products — like Maxeon solar panels from SunPower or Tesla Powerwall batteries — so choosing those installers will generally cost more. It’s best to do some research and go with the company that has the products, warranties and services you’re looking for and also is within your budget.

How to Save on Solar Panels
The company that does your system installation will affect the warranties and brands available to you, and it will also have an impact on your total cost. Since selecting a company can be a challenge, we have some tips to help you, such as:
- Solar Panel Brands: The model of solar panel you want to install plays a part in which installer you should go with, since different companies have different panels.
- Contract: When reading through your solar company’s contract, ask for clarification about any terms you’re not sure of and be sure you understand what happens in scenarios such as a system part breaking or if the company goes out of business.
- Installation Process: An important thing to understand when going solar is the installation process itself. Be sure to align on any details you need to know with your solar installer, such as what permits you should secure and what the project timeline is.
- Reputation: The North American Board of Certified Energy Practitioners (NABCEP) is a respected certification organization for clean energy professionals. If your solar panel installer is NABCEP-certified, it likely has a good reputation and is qualified to do the job well. Another way you can look into your installer’s reputation is by reading reviews.

Is cost the most important thing to consider when buying solar panels?
The initial cost is a crucial factor to consider, but whether it’s the most important for you depends on why you decided to go solar. In places where rooftop space is limited, efficiency can trump the cost. Other factors that are important to keep in mind are the quality and durability of your solar panels.
Do solar panels increase your home value?
Solar panels can increase the value of your property by about 4%, according to research done by Zillow. How long do solar panels last in Marbletown?
On average, the lifespan of solar panels is about 25 to 30 years. Some even last up to 50 years, but their efficiency goes down by about 0.8% each year. You can choose to replace them sooner if you want to maintain a larger amount of energy production.
